Smadex logo Smadex

Smadex is a programmatic advertising platform for agencies and brands.

WellnessLiving logo WellnessLiving

Wellness Living is a cloud based software features real-time appointment and class scheduling, POS, email and SMS marketing, customer review management, etc.
